Advertisement Brasilia: Brazil’s presidential election is 15 months away, yet barely a day passes without President Jair Bolsonaro raising the spectre of fraud and warning that he will be entitled to reject the results unless Congress overhauls the voting system. He has mentioned potential vote fraud more than 20 times in the past two months and even floated the idea of cancelling the election altogether. “I don’t mind handing over the government next year, to whomever it is, but with an honest vote, not with fraud,” Bolsonaro told supporters July 1 outside the presidential residence. Later that day, he was harping on the issue again. “They say I don’t have proof of fraud. You don’t have proof that there’s no fraud either!” ....
